1) Unsafe reflection

EUVDB-ID: #VU65653

Risk: Medium

CVSSv3.1: 7 [CVSS:3.1/AV:N/AC:L/PR:N/UI:N/S:U/C:L/I:L/A:L/E:H/RL:O/RC:C]

CVE-ID: CVE-2014-0114

CWE-ID: CWE-470 - Use of Externally-Controlled Input to Select Classes or Code ('Unsafe Reflection')

Exploit availability: Yes

Description

The vulnerability allows a remote attacker to execute arbitrary code on the target system.

The vulnerability exists due to Apache Commons BeanUtils does not suppress the class property. A remote unauthenticated attacker can manipulate the ClassLoader and execute arbitrary code via the class parameter

Mitigation

Install update from vendor's website.

Vulnerable software versions

Operational Decision Manager: before 8.11.1 Interim fix 4

2) Protection mechanism failure

EUVDB-ID: #VU20844

Risk: Low

CVSSv3.1: 3.2 [CVSS:3.1/AV:N/AC:H/PR:N/UI:N/S:U/C:N/I:L/A:N/E:U/RL:O/RC:C]

CVE-ID: CVE-2019-10086

CWE-ID: CWE-693 - Protection Mechanism Failure

Exploit availability: No

Description

The vulnerability allows a remote attacker to bypass certain security restrictions.

The vulnerability exist due to Beanutils is not using by default the a special BeanIntrospector class in PropertyUtilsBean that was supposed to suppress the ability for an attacker to access the classloader via the class property available on all Java objects. A remote attacker can abuse such application behavior against applications that were developed to rely on this security feature.

Mitigation

Install update from vendor's website.

Vulnerable software versions

Operational Decision Manager: before 8.11.1 Interim fix 4

3) Allocation of Resources Without Limits or Throttling

EUVDB-ID: #VU72427

Risk: Medium

CVSSv3.1: 6.5 [CVSS:3.1/AV:N/AC:L/PR:N/UI:N/S:U/C:N/I:N/A:H/E:U/RL:O/RC:C]

CVE-ID: CVE-2023-24998

CWE-ID: CWE-770 - Allocation of Resources Without Limits or Throttling

Exploit availability: No

Description

The vulnerability allows a remote attacker to perform a denial of service (DoS) attack.

The vulnerability exists due to Apache Commons FileUpload does not limit the number of request parts. A remote attacker can initiate a series of uploads and perform a denial of service (DoS) attack.

Mitigation

Install update from vendor's website.

Vulnerable software versions

Operational Decision Manager: before 8.11.1 Interim fix 4
